Transaction 5083694f91c245f6ad7c9942e7f4e4259a210ffd90cbd81f0bb95100d134fa9e

1 Input
2 Outputs
  • 5083694f91c245f6ad7c9942e7f4e4259a210ffd90cbd81f0bb95100d134fa9e:0
  • value  867753
    address  3P2QzPVMDq9DEgiEyvjtKHQajfhnM8rP4C
  • 5083694f91c245f6ad7c9942e7f4e4259a210ffd90cbd81f0bb95100d134fa9e:1
  • value  76599
    address  3JVC4HHDD2VbZD69hAkXStZPTsnpyLc7wR